Amazon's Trainium Chip Sales Could Challenge Nvidia
Amazon launched its Trainium AI chips for AWS in 2022 and could start selling them to third-party customers. This could challenge Nvidia's dominance in the AI market. Amazon's Trainium3 chips can't compete with Nvidia's top-tier Blackwell GPUs on their own, but by densely stacking them, Amazon can match Nvidia's performance at a lower cost. This could lead to a decrease in Nvidia's market share and stock price.

Prompt Injection Attacks Trick AI Agents
Threat actors are using prompt injection attacks to trick AI agents into making payments or trusting fraudulent cryptocurrency platforms. Zscaler identified two campaigns using indirect prompt injection, including a payment scam and a typosquatting operation promoting a crypto platform.

L'Oreal and Mondelez Use AI in Product Development
L'Oreal and Mondelez are using AI in their product development processes to speed up innovation. AI helps generate recipe ideas, reduces the number of physical samples, and tweaks formulas.
Small Businesses Adopt AI, Budget for Failures
Small businesses are quickly adopting AI, but also budgeting for failures, fixes, and usage controls. A US Chamber of Commerce survey shows 58% of small businesses used generative AI in 2025, up from 23% in 2023.
Top Economist Warns of AI Productivity Hype
Top economist Torsten Slok warns that AI may not deliver on its productivity promises, leading to a market repricing. He argues that AI deployment is slow due to regulatory hurdles, data protection, and workflow integration.
AI Fuels Rise in Cyberattacks on Small Businesses
An international coalition of intelligence agencies warns that AI is fueling a rise in cyberattacks on small businesses and local governments. Experts recommend updating security systems, staying alert to suspicious emails, and taking protective measures.
